i'm trying to make an addon for a mod

i made a tool that when right clicked on a block remove a 3x3 area and drop the destroyed blocks, but there are compatibility issues with anti-griefing things (like towny)

it's possible to make it call the block break event (that towny should recognize) before destroying blocks?

The flow of logic you need is rather simple,

 

When picking the middle block and it breaks, a blockBreakEvent is triggered, in that event find the surrounding blocks do your check logic and break them in code. If you go though the same breaking mechanism minecraft has implemented other mods should not complain.

 

Steps in a list

[*]Listen on break event

[*]Find surrounding blocks and apply check logic

[*]Break the discovered blocks
